(St. Leon, Ind.) - A threatening post on Instagram has Sunman-Dearborn Community Schools and law enforcement pursuing charges against an East Central High School student.
The threatening Instagram post was reported to school staff on Monday, April 29, according to a letter sent to parents by Sunman-Dearborn Community Schools Superintendent Andrew Jackson. Administrators say the student who allegedly made the post was immediately located and questioned.
The student was then detained and arrested by the Dearborn County Sheriff’s Office. His locker and a school bus were also searched, but no weapons were found.
“School administration will pursue the most severe consequences allowed by the school handbook and Indiana Code,” Jackson wrote in the parent letter.
He added that the schools take all threats to safety seriously. He encouraged people to report when they “see or hear something.”
